Consideration of highest and best use.

WebWhen determining what use would constitute the highest and best use, the appraiser needs to consider many possible uses of the property. A potential use cannot be considered to be the highest and best use unless it is all four of the following: 1. Legally allowable 2. Physically possible 3. Financially feasible 4. WebEven though the “highest and best use” notion has been defined its' interpretation causes many ambiguities and problems. “Highest value” is a condition that requires taking into … WebIn deciding which highest and best use test constraint to apply first, an appraiser may find it helpful to: Apply the more restrictive constraint first What is the typical result when an improvement does not represent the highest and best use of the land as vacant? The improvement suffers functional obsolescence

WebThe land may be suitable for a much higher, or more intense, use. For instance, the highest and best use of a parcel of land as though vacant may be for a 10-story office building, while the office building that currently occupies the site has only three floors." 3 WebThe Major Land Uses (MLU) series is the longest running, most comprehensive accounting of all major uses of public and private land in the United States.
